Honda Freed: Which Version Should You Buy?
The Honda Freed in this catalogue spans two Compact Van generations: the first from May 2008 to September 2011 and the second from September 2016 to September 2019. Each generation contains four versions, all using a 1,496 cc Inline four-cylinder engine, but their outputs, transmissions, drive systems, weights, and performance differ substantially.

The first-generation buyer chooses among an 88 hp Hybrid 1.5 CVT and 118 hp Gasoline versions with CVT or 5-speed Automatic transmissions. The second generation raises output to 110 hp for the Hybrid 1.5 I-Shift and 131 hp for the Gasoline 1.5 CVT. In practical terms, the quickest recorded choice is the second-generation 110 hp 1.5 I-Shift FWD at 10.5 seconds to 100 km/h, while the lightest is the first-generation 118 hp 1.5 CVT FWD at 1,270 kg.
Honda Freed generations: what changed?
The first-generation Honda Freed was produced from May 2008 through September 2011 as a Compact Van, with four listed versions. All have 1,496 cc, naturally aspirated Inline four-cylinder engines with four valves per cylinder and Distributed injection (multi-point). The Hybrid 1.5 CVT develops 88 hp and 135 Nm, while the three Gasoline alternatives develop 118 hp and 144 Nm. The generation offers both FWD and AWD, a Variable transmission on three versions, and a 5-speed Automatic on the 1.5 AT AWD.
The second-generation Honda Freed covered September 2016 through September 2019, again as a Compact Van with four versions. Its 1,496 cc, naturally aspirated Inline four-cylinder engines use Direct injection (direct), with four valves per cylinder. The Hybrid 1.5 I-Shift produces 110 hp and 134 Nm and uses a 7-speed Robotic gearbox; the Gasoline 1.5 CVT produces 131 hp and 155 Nm with a Variable transmission. Both powertrains are listed with FWD and AWD.
Compared with the first-generation Hybrid, the second-generation Hybrid gains 22 hp but loses 1 Nm. Its specific output rises from about 58.8 hp per litre to about 73.5 hp per litre. The second-generation Gasoline engine adds 13 hp and 11 Nm over the first-generation Gasoline engine, increasing specific output from about 78.9 to 87.6 hp per litre.
Honda Freed engine specs and version comparison
Because identical version names occur with different drive systems, the drive and power output are included below to keep every version unambiguous.
| Generation and version | Power | Torque | Displacement | Fuel | Cylinders and layout | Boost | Gearbox | Drive |
|---|---|---|---|---|---|---|---|---|
| First generation 1.5 CVT, Hybrid FWD | 88 hp | 135 Nm | 1,496 cc | Hybrid, 95 | 4, Inline | No | Variable | FWD |
| First generation 1.5 AT, Gasoline AWD | 118 hp | 144 Nm | 1,496 cc | Gasoline, 92 | 4, Inline | No | 5-speed Automatic | AWD |
| First generation 1.5 CVT, Gasoline FWD | 118 hp | 144 Nm | 1,496 cc | Gasoline, 92 | 4, Inline | No | Variable | FWD |
| First generation 1.5 CVT, Gasoline AWD | 118 hp | 144 Nm | 1,496 cc | Gasoline, 92 | 4, Inline | No | Variable | AWD |
| Second generation 1.5 I-Shift, Hybrid FWD | 110 hp | 134 Nm | 1,496 cc | Hybrid, 95 | 4, Inline | No | 7-speed Robotic | FWD |
| Second generation 1.5 I-Shift, Hybrid AWD | 110 hp | 134 Nm | 1,496 cc | Hybrid, 95 | 4, Inline | No | 7-speed Robotic | AWD |
| Second generation 1.5 CVT, Gasoline FWD | 131 hp | 155 Nm | 1,496 cc | Gasoline, 95 | 4, Inline | No | Variable | FWD |
| Second generation 1.5 CVT, Gasoline AWD | 131 hp | 155 Nm | 1,496 cc | Gasoline, 95 | 4, Inline | No | Variable | AWD |
The Gasoline engine is the stronger option within either generation. In the first generation, its 118 hp exceeds the Hybrid’s 88 hp by 30 hp, and its 144 Nm exceeds 135 Nm by 9 Nm. In the second generation, the Gasoline 1.5 CVT has 21 hp and 21 Nm more than the Hybrid 1.5 I-Shift.
Performance, mpg, and economy data
| Generation and version | 0–100 km/h | Top speed | City consumption | Highway consumption | Combined consumption |
|---|---|---|---|---|---|
| First generation 1.5 CVT, Hybrid FWD, 88 hp | 12.3 s | not measured | not measured | not measured | not measured |
| First generation 1.5 AT, Gasoline AWD, 118 hp | 12.9 s | 170 km/h | not measured | not measured | not measured |
| First generation 1.5 CVT, Gasoline FWD, 118 hp | 12.3 s | not measured | not measured | not measured | not measured |
| First generation 1.5 CVT, Gasoline AWD, 118 hp | not measured | 170 km/h | not measured | not measured | not measured |
| Second generation 1.5 I-Shift, Hybrid FWD, 110 hp | 10.5 s | not measured | not measured | not measured | not measured |
| Second generation 1.5 I-Shift, Hybrid AWD, 110 hp | 10.9 s | not measured | not measured | not measured | not measured |
| Second generation 1.5 CVT, Gasoline FWD, 131 hp | 11.8 s | not measured | not measured | not measured | not measured |
| Second generation 1.5 CVT, Gasoline AWD, 131 hp | 12.9 s | not measured | not measured | not measured | not measured |
No city, highway, or combined fuel-consumption figure was measured for any listed Honda Freed version, so the data cannot support an mpg ranking between Hybrid and Gasoline choices. The only measured top-speed figures are 170 km/h for the first-generation 1.5 AT Gasoline AWD and 170 km/h for the first-generation 1.5 CVT Gasoline AWD.
Acceleration provides a clearer comparison. The second-generation 1.5 I-Shift Hybrid FWD reaches 100 km/h in 10.5 seconds, 0.4 seconds ahead of its AWD counterpart. With the second-generation Gasoline 1.5 CVT, the FWD version records 11.8 seconds and the AWD version 12.9 seconds, a difference of 1.1 seconds. Despite producing 21 hp less, the second-generation Hybrid FWD is 1.3 seconds quicker to 100 km/h than the Gasoline FWD in the supplied measurements.
Honda Freed weight, ground clearance, tank, and wheel sizes
| Generation and version | Kerb weight | Gross weight | Weight per horsepower | Ground clearance | Tank | Wheel sizes |
|---|---|---|---|---|---|---|
| First generation 1.5 CVT, Hybrid FWD, 88 hp | 1,390 kg | not measured | about 15.8 kg/hp | 150 mm | 42 L | not measured |
| First generation 1.5 AT, Gasoline AWD, 118 hp | 1,360 kg | not measured | about 11.5 kg/hp | 150 mm | 42 L | not measured |
| First generation 1.5 CVT, Gasoline FWD, 118 hp | 1,270 kg | not measured | about 10.8 kg/hp | 150 mm | 42 L | not measured |
| First generation 1.5 CVT, Gasoline AWD, 118 hp | 1,360 kg | not measured | about 11.5 kg/hp | 150 mm | 42 L | not measured |
| Second generation 1.5 I-Shift, Hybrid FWD, 110 hp | 1,400 kg | not measured | about 12.7 kg/hp | 135 mm | 36 L | not measured |
| Second generation 1.5 I-Shift, Hybrid AWD, 110 hp | 1,480 kg | not measured | about 13.5 kg/hp | 150 mm | 36 L | not measured |
| Second generation 1.5 CVT, Gasoline FWD, 131 hp | 1,340 kg | not measured | about 10.2 kg/hp | 135 mm | 36 L | not measured |
| Second generation 1.5 CVT, Gasoline AWD, 131 hp | 1,410 kg | not measured | about 10.8 kg/hp | 150 mm | 36 L | not measured |
The first-generation 118 hp 1.5 CVT FWD has the lowest kerb weight at 1,270 kg. Its AWD counterpart weighs 90 kg more. In the second generation, choosing AWD adds 80 kg to the Hybrid 1.5 I-Shift and 70 kg to the Gasoline 1.5 CVT.
The best calculated weight-to-power result belongs to the second-generation 131 hp 1.5 CVT FWD at about 10.2 kg per horsepower. The first-generation 118 hp 1.5 CVT FWD follows at about 10.8 kg per horsepower, essentially matching the second-generation 131 hp AWD version on this measure.
Ground clearance is 150 mm on every first-generation version and both second-generation AWD versions. The second-generation FWD versions have 135 mm, giving the AWD alternatives 15 mm more clearance. Tank capacity falls from 42 L in the first generation to 36 L in the second, a reduction of 6 L. Gross weight and wheel sizes were not measured for any version, so weight capacity and wheel-size comparisons cannot be made.
Which Honda Freed version should you choose?
For the quickest measured acceleration, choose the second-generation 1.5 I-Shift Hybrid FWD with 110 hp. Its 10.5-second result is the best in the catalogue, and its 1,400 kg kerb weight is 80 kg below the AWD 1.5 I-Shift. The trade-off is 135 mm of ground clearance rather than 150 mm.
For the strongest engine and best calculated weight-to-power ratio, choose the second-generation 1.5 CVT Gasoline FWD with 131 hp and 155 Nm. It delivers about 87.6 hp per litre and carries about 10.2 kg per horsepower. However, its measured 0–100 km/h time is 11.8 seconds, so the higher engine output does not make it the quickest recorded version.
For AWD with the fastest measured acceleration, the second-generation 1.5 I-Shift Hybrid AWD is the leading choice at 10.9 seconds to 100 km/h. It weighs 1,480 kg, making it the heaviest listed Freed, but it provides 150 mm of ground clearance.
For the lowest kerb weight, select the first-generation 1.5 CVT Gasoline FWD with 118 hp. At 1,270 kg, it is 120 kg lighter than the first-generation Hybrid and 70 kg lighter than the second-generation Gasoline FWD. Its 12.3-second acceleration matches the first-generation Hybrid while offering 30 hp more.
For a first-generation AWD model with a measured top speed, both the 118 hp 1.5 AT and the 118 hp 1.5 CVT are listed at 170 km/h. Both weigh 1,360 kg, have 150 mm of clearance, and use a 42 L tank. Their main recorded distinction is transmission type: the 1.5 AT has a 5-speed Automatic, while the 1.5 CVT has a Variable transmission. Acceleration is 12.9 seconds for the 1.5 AT and not measured for the AWD 1.5 CVT.
No reliability, problem, price, interior-dimension, fuel-consumption, gross-weight, or wheel-size measurements are present in the supplied data. Those factors therefore cannot determine the recommendation. On the available numbers alone, the second-generation 1.5 I-Shift Hybrid FWD is the acceleration choice, the second-generation 1.5 CVT Gasoline FWD is the power-to-weight choice, and the first-generation 1.5 CVT Gasoline FWD is the low-kerb-weight choice.
